WebPSHE theme 1: Health and Wellbeing The PSHE Association advises that children should be taught: What constitutes a healthy lifestyle, including the benefits of physical activity, rest, … melba\\u0027s chicken and wafflesWebDeveloping emotional maturity; learning that we experience a range of emotions and are responsible for these; appreciating the emotions of others; developing a growth mindset; identifying calming and relaxing activities; developing independence in dental hygiene Y4 Safety and the changing body Y4 Citizenship Year 4: Transition lesson naps during covidWebThere are three core themes of primary school PSHE: 1. Health and Wellbeing 2. Relationships 3. Living in the Wider World: economic wellbeing and being a responsible citizen.
